Med Cards, also known as medical cards or healthcare cards, are essential tools for individuals to store vital medical information in a compact and easily accessible format. These cards typically include details such as allergies, medications, medical history, and emergency contact information. For healthcare professionals, med cards can streamline patient care by providing a quick reference to essential patient data.

Layout and Structure

Clear and Concise Information: Organize information in a logical and easy-to-read manner. Use headings and subheadings to separate different sections.

  • Essential Fields: Include essential fields such as patient name, date of birth, blood type, allergies, medications, medical history, and emergency contact information. Consider adding optional fields like insurance information and organ donor status.
  • Emergency Contact Information: Ensure that emergency contact information is prominently displayed and easily accessible. Include fields for name, relationship, phone number, and address.
  • QR Code Integration: Consider integrating a QR code that links to a digital version of the med card. This allows for easy access to updated information and can be scanned by healthcare professionals.

  • Design Elements

    Professional Typography: Choose fonts that are legible and easy to read, such as Arial, Helvetica, or Verdana. Avoid excessive use of decorative fonts that may be difficult to decipher.

  • Color Scheme: Select a color scheme that is visually appealing and professional. Consider using soft, neutral colors that create a calming and trustworthy atmosphere.
  • Branding: Incorporate your brand’s colors, logo, and style guidelines into the template design. This helps to establish a consistent and recognizable identity.
  • White Space: Use white space effectively to create a clean and uncluttered layout. Avoid overcrowding the card with too much information.
  • Alignment: Align text and elements consistently throughout the template. This creates a sense of order and professionalism.

  • Functionality and Usability

    User-Friendly Interface: Design the template to be intuitive and easy to navigate. Avoid complex layouts or confusing information.

  • Customizable Fields: Allow users to add or remove fields as needed to accommodate their specific medical information.
  • Printable Format: Ensure that the template can be easily printed on standard letter-sized paper. Consider providing options for different paper sizes or orientations.
  • Digital Storage: Offer the option to save the med card as a digital file (e.g., PDF, image). This allows for easy sharing and backup.

  • Accessibility

    Large Font Options: Provide options for larger font sizes to accommodate users with visual impairments.

  • High Contrast: Ensure that the color scheme provides sufficient contrast between text and background to improve readability.
  • Keyboard Navigation: Design the template to be navigable using only a keyboard, allowing users with limited mobility to access information.

  • Security and Privacy

    Data Protection: Implement measures to protect patient data from unauthorized access. Consider using encryption or password protection.

  • Regular Updates: Encourage users to regularly update their med card information to ensure accuracy and completeness.
  • Compliance: Adhere to relevant data privacy regulations, such as HIPAA in the United States or GDPR in the European Union.
